Requisite Supplier Hub, the collaborative trading platform launched by Requisite Technology in July, has reported rapid adoption. More than 300 suppliers and 55 buying organisations in 11 vertical markets have registered, it says. www.requisite.com

Capita is in talks with IT specialist Achilles over ways to improve Constructionline, the industry contractor and client vetting service that it jointly owns with the Department of Trade and Industry.
British Telecommunications is considering outsourcing the management and maintenance of its vehicles to a fleet leasing operator as part of an ongoing debt review. “While there is no specific plan as yet, we are looking at flexible and innovative solutions for our support services, in particular our vehicles,” a spokesperson told SM.
Train operators could claim retrospective compensation from Railtrack for the deterioration of the rail network in the wake of last October’s crash at Hatfield. Although clauses in their contracts apply only to specific speed restrictions and future losses, the firms hope to claim for lost business since the accident.
